Python 字符串 format 拼接 None 的实现

1. 引言

在Python中,字符串的拼接是常见的操作。有时我们需要将变量或者其他字符串与None拼接在一起。本文将向刚入行的小白开发者介绍如何使用Python的字符串格式化方法format()来实现这一目标。

2. 解决方案概述

下面是实现该目标的步骤概述:

步骤 描述
1 创建一个字符串模板
2 使用format()方法将None插入模板中
3 输出拼接后的字符串

在下面的内容中,我们将详细介绍每个步骤及其代码实现。

3. 步骤详解

步骤1:创建一个字符串模板

首先,我们需要创建一个字符串模板,该模板将作为我们的目标字符串。我们可以使用花括号{}来表示模板中的占位符,稍后我们将用format()方法将None插入这些占位符。

template = "This is a template with a placeholder for None: {}"

步骤2:使用format()方法将None插入模板中

接下来,我们将使用format()方法将None插入到步骤1中创建的模板中。format()方法使用花括号{}中的占位符来指示要插入的值。我们可以使用{:}这样的占位符来表示要插入None的位置。

formatted_string = template.format(None)

步骤3:输出拼接后的字符串

最后,我们可以通过打印拼接后的字符串来查看结果。

print(formatted_string)

4. 完整代码示例

下面是完整的示例代码:

template = "This is a template with a placeholder for None: {}"
formatted_string = template.format(None)
print(formatted_string)

执行上述代码,将输出以下结果:

This is a template with a placeholder for None: None

5. 类图

classDiagram
    class Developer {
        + experience: int
        + teach(beginner: Developer): void
    }

6. 总结

本文介绍了如何使用Python的字符串格式化方法format()来实现拼接字符串和None。通过创建一个字符串模板,使用format()方法将None插入模板中,最后输出拼接后的字符串,我们可以轻松地实现这一目标。希望本文对刚入行的小白开发者有所帮助!